LOS ANGELES, CALIFORNIA: Actor Taylor Lautner and his wife, Tay Lautner on Sunday, June 7, revealed that they are expecting a baby girl. The couple shared the news in an emotional gender reveal video posted to Instagram, showing the moment they learned the gender of their first child together.

The announcement comes months after the pair confirmed they were expecting their first baby. Lautner later said becoming a father to a daughter had long been a personal dream.

Couple shares emotional gender reveal moment

The video, posted jointly on the couple’s Instagram accounts, captured them sitting together on a couch as they logged into an online portal to learn the baby's gender. “Our little secret is now yours,” they captioned the post.

As the final prompt appeared on the screen, the couple held hands and prepared to see the result. When the word “girl” appeared in pink lettering, Lautner threw his arms into the air while Tay covered her mouth and became emotional. Taylor immediately embraced his wife as the pair celebrated the moment together.

Following the announcement, Lautner reflected on the news in a message shared on Instagram Stories. “My dream has always been to become a girl dad,” he wrote.

The actor explained that many of the most important people in his life are women, including his mother, sister, wife and several close friends.

“All I wanted was a healthy baby but deep down this moment is what I was dreaming of. The weight that was lifted off my shoulders in this moment knowing that dream came true was unlike anything I’ve felt,” he wrote.

He added, “Tay is the strongest person I know and my hero. I can’t wait to welcome this baby girl into our world. Team girl!”

First child expected after pregnancy announcement earlier this year

The couple first announced they were expecting their first child on March 26, sharing photos from a maternity shoot and a sonogram image. Taylor and Tay, whose maiden name is Taylor Dome, have been together since 2018 and married in November 2022 after becoming engaged in 2021.

Throughout the pregnancy, the couple has frequently shared updates with followers. In May, Tay discussed some of the challenges she has experienced during pregnancy while speaking on her podcast, The Squeeze.

She said she had struggled with comparisons to other expectant mothers during her second trimester. "I've never really struggled with comparison, but I've definitely found myself comparing my pregnant body to other pregnant women, especially the women that are weeks away from giving birth and are still all skinny and fit," Tay said.

She also recently praised her husband’s support throughout the pregnancy, describing him as a constant source of help and encouragement. "He's been my saving grace," she said. "He has been so helpful, running around, doing all of the things, picking up random food, filling up my water with ice 27 times a day."

The couple has not publicly disclosed a due date, but they are preparing to welcome their daughter later this year.
